Hi,

I own a MacBook and now I bought myself a fantastic iMac.
I used Dropbox on my Mac before to have all the stuff with me(especially for college etc.). I created local folders and linked them with macdropany.

My question is how can I do the same on my new iMac?
I think I have to do it the other way round. Sync dropbox and then create symbolic links to those folders i want in my home folder, or is there a better solution(especially to avoid the dropbox checkmarks)
 
If you install Dropbox on both Macs, then what's in your Dropbox folder should be the same on both Macs. If you add a file on your MacBook, then once it's uploaded, you see it on your iMac.
